Output e62e40eccd28e6be15cc134dc4568c6457f49a4d21e204bc9ef221ffb69ab5b4:0

value
677899
script pubkey
OP_HASH160 OP_PUSHBYTES_20 edd385e048976082e204335307ffbf5b51b3c9c9 OP_EQUAL
address
3PNXTszftkaTiXwWwD7QYqa8ENx1UdJsmV
transaction
e62e40eccd28e6be15cc134dc4568c6457f49a4d21e204bc9ef221ffb69ab5b4